During the past few decades in particular, India has experienced a blossoming of the arts on a scale not seen since the time of the great Mughals in the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ries.

Summary/Abstract |
This pioneering book is an authentic portrayal of the formative years of modern Indian art, when its parameters were being established. Between its hesitant beginnings in British -established art schools, and the inspired individualism of many present day artists, lies the story of the Progressive Artists Group. These young painters, who rebelled both against the Bengal school, as well as the naturalism introduced by the art schools, met frequently, holding night-long discussions in their struggle to survive in the dramatic development of contemporary Indian art.
